Legal Issues
- 1 Whether the prosecution has established a prima facie case against the accused to warrant his being placed on his defence.
Ratio Decidendi
The court found that the prosecution, having called four witnesses, presented sufficient evidence to establish a prima facie case against the accused. Consequently, the accused is required to be placed on his defence in accordance with the law. The ruling does not determine guilt but confirms that the prosecution's evidence meets the threshold to call for a defence under the applicable legal standards.

RULING
The accused person is facing a charge of Murder, Contrary to Section 203 as read with Section 204 of the Penal Code. The Prosecution called four (4) witnesses in support of its case.
I have considered all the evidence on record and I am satisfied that the Prosecution has established a prima facie case against the accused. I hereby place the accused on his defence.
